Ordinals
beta
Sat 1307970172149306
decimal
313188.172149306
degree
0°103188′708″172149306‴
percentile
62.28429398038446%
name
eovspddohjz
cycle
0
epoch
1
period
155
block
313188
offset
172149306
timestamp
2014-07-30 15:28:52 UTC
rarity
common
prev
next